The meeting point of the play, where it all comes together, is the Hotel Confidence with its lobby and its Restaurant, the "Pancomedia". The "fool", small time publisher Zacharias Werner, is trying with varying success to stand up against the pressure of a major publisher. His "wife" is author Sylvia Kessel, whose second novel he wants to publish. He meets with several potential patrons of the arts, a certain brother in law Oswald, who likes to pass his time pelting his lover with pebbles, and the wealthy Ina Schmoeling-Knecht, who lures the publisher into her bed, but then still won't part with the money.

Relationships are played out, deals made, projects drafted and abandoned. The establishment, members and onlookers of the cultural scene are trying to drown out their existential crisis, desires and disappointments.

World premiere
07.04.2001 Schauspielhaus Bochum (Director: Matthias Hartmann)
